Welcome to Magdalen Gates Primary School 
Working together to give every child the best 
Magdalen Gates Primary School is a good school (Ofsted, June 2025). Proudly known as “the village school on the edge of the city,” we are defined by our warm, welcoming, and close-knit community spirit. Our school is home to seven single-age classes, where we nurture a diverse and inclusive environment in which every child can thrive. We are proud of our progress and are continually striving to improve, ensuring we provide the very best for every child in our care.

Vision and Values Statement

Working together to give every child the best is at the heart of everything that we do at Magdalen Gates Primary School.  

 We believe that positive relationships are essential for learning and growth: So we all work together to keep children safe and to help them learn. 

  • We believe in equality of opportunity: So we celebrate diversity and work to make inclusion a reality for all. Everyone belongs and everyone can flourish at Magdalen Gates. 

  • We believe in giving children the best start in life: So we focus on learning, keeping children safe and provide opportunities to develop cultural capital every day.
